What is the difference between Digital Transformation Analyst vs Data Analyst?

AspectDigital Transformation AnalystData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Business, IT, or related field; certifications in project management or digital toolsBachelor's in Statistics, Mathematics, or related field; certifications in data analysis tools
Work EnvironmentCollaborates across departments to implement digital initiatives, often in corporate or tech settingsAnalyzes data sets to generate reports, typically in finance, marketing, or healthcare sectors
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by organizations undergoing digital change, in industries like finance, retail, and techCommon in data-driven roles across various industries including healthcare, finance, and marketing

While both roles involve working with digital tools, the Digital Transformation Analyst focuses on implementing digital strategies and process improvements, whereas the Data Analyst primarily interprets data to support decision-making.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or job search focus.

What is a digital transformation analyst?

A Digital Transformation Analyst is a professional who helps organizations leverage digital technologies to improve business processes, enhance customer experiences, and drive overall efficiency. They analyze current systems, identify areas for digital improvement, and recommend solutions such as new software, automation tools, or process changes. Their role involves collaborating with various departments to ensure smooth integration of digital initiatives and tracking the outcomes to measure success. By bridging the gap between technology and business goals, Digital Transformation Analysts play a key role in guiding companies through change.

How does a digital transformation analyst typically collaborate with cross-functional teams to implement new technologies?

As a Digital Transformation Analyst, you'll work closely with departments such as IT, operations, marketing, and finance to assess current processes and identify opportunities for digital improvement. Collaboration often involves leading workshops, gathering requirements, and translating business needs into actionable technology solutions. You may also facilitate communication between technical and non-technical stakeholders to ensure successful project adoption. Effective teamwork and clear communication are essential, as you'll frequently coordinate with various teams to drive organization-wide transformation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a digital transformation analyst?

To thrive as a Digital Transformation Analyst, you need strong analytical abilities, business process knowledge, and a background in information technology or related fields, often supported by a bachelor's degree. Familiarity with digital transformation frameworks, data analytics tools (like Power BI or Tableau), project management software, and certifications such as Agile or Six Sigma is highly beneficial.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and change management skills help you bridge gaps between technical teams and business stakeholders. These competencies are essential for driving effective digital initiatives that align technology with organizational goals and ensure successful transformation outcomes.
